吡咯烷二硫代氨基甲酯抑制TNF-α和MMP-9表达延缓大鼠颈椎间盘退变及机制研究

【摘要】:目的观察吡咯烷二硫代氨基甲酯(PDTC)对大鼠颈椎动力失衡模型颈椎间盘组织形态及肿瘤坏死因子α(TNF-α)、基质金属蛋白酶9(MMP-9)表达的影响,探讨PDTC抑制颈椎间盘退变作用及其机制。方法 54只SD大鼠随机分为3组,切断大鼠颈后部浅、深肌群构建颈椎间盘退变动物模型。PDTC给药组(A组):造模术后腹腔每日注射PDTC溶液。模型组(B组):造模术后腹腔每日注射生理盐水。假手术组(C组):手术切开大鼠颈后部皮肤后立即缝合并每日腹腔注射生理盐水。术后10、12、16周分批处死动物,获取C5/6椎间盘组织,光镜下观察椎间盘形态改变,qPCR检测椎间盘组织中TNF-αmRNA、MMP-9 mRNA表达;Western blot检测椎间盘组织中TNF-α、MMP-9蛋白表达变化。结果 PDTC给药组(A组)椎间盘结构破坏减轻,纤维环结构排列有序。模型组(B组)TNF-α、MMP-9基因表达量随实验时间的延长而增多,早期增速较快,后期逐渐缓慢,在12周达高峰,而蛋白表达量在术后10周即达到较高水平,与12周、16周时间点比较无明显差异(P0.05)。各时间点PDTC给药组TNF-αmRNA、MMP-9 mRNA及蛋白表达量较模型组(B组)明显降低(P0.01),但明显高于假手术组(P0.01)。结论 TNF-α、MMP-9是参与大鼠颈椎间盘退变过程的重要炎性因子,TNF-α、MMP-9可能通过NF-κB信号通路参与大鼠颈椎间盘退变,PDTC有望成为颈椎间盘退变的防治药物。
